Plans for an aerial park using the "space frame" supporting the Hy-Vee Arena roof include ziplines extending over the Kaw River and a harness course utilizing the frame.

Ziplines, Aerial Park Envisioned for Hy-Vee Arena ‘Space Frame’

Brad McDonald plans to open an “aerial park” featuring ziplines that cross the Kansas River atop the Hy-Vee Arena in the West Bottoms.

A conceptual rendering of a street scene in a part of the SomeraRoad plan for a six-block section of the West Bottoms.

City Agrees on Framework of $400M West Bottoms Redevelopment Plan

The City Council has approved plans for an estimated $400 million redevelopment plan in the West Bottoms that would ultimately add 1,250 apartments.
